Roswell Strange is awesome and shares all the teas with me so when she exploded my cupboard in December, this was among the tea explosion. In addition, she also gave me the Hojicha Dark Roast from the same company to try so today I am trying them side by side.

I steeped them according to Hojicha Co’s instructions: 8 g/250 mL in 80C water for this one and 90C water for the Dark Roast for 30 seconds.

Hojicha is not my favorite but as far as they go, this one is quite nice. It’s got the classic hojicha roastiness of course but it is very smooth. It is sort of two note in the sense that the front of the sip is a sweeter/umami flavor and the back end of the sip is when the roast pops up and lingers in the aftertaste. I think that makes the roastiness stand out a bit more so if that’s the quality that you want in a hojicha, this has it in spades.

The website boasts caramel sweetness for this one but I am not really getting that. Unless it is umami caramel, that is a little burnt.

Thank you Roswell Strange for sharing both teas. Of the two, I thought for sure this would be my preference but while I can tell it is a good quality hojicha, I much prefer the dark roast.

Gongfu!

This was a Sunday session paired with some very juicy and sour gooseberries! I’ve enjoyed hojicha when paired with lemon or yuzu in the past, so I thought the bright acidity of the gooseberries might pair really well. It’s an alright pairing, but the gooseberries over power the roast of this green tea so I’ve had to adapt to eating the gooseberries in between steeps and then waiting until the taste is just lingering on the palate before sipping. However, with this adjustment it’s working quite nicely!!
